Historical Notions of Time
The concept of time has been a fundamental aspect of human civilization for thousands of years. Early cultures devised various ways to measure time, such as sundials, water clocks, and calendars. The ancient Egyptians were among the first to develop a solar calendar, while the Mayans constructed a complex calendar system that tracked celestial events with remarkable accuracy.
Time also held profound significance in philosophy. Ancient Greek philosophers like Heraclitus and Parmenides pondered the nature of time. Heraclitus famously stated, “You cannot step into the same river twice,” emphasizing the ever-changing and impermanent nature of time. Parmenides, on the other hand, argued for a timeless, unchanging reality.
The Subjective Experience of Time
Our perception of time is subjective and can vary greatly depending on circumstances. The phenomenon of “time dilation” is evident when we experience time passing at different rates. For example, time may seem to crawl during moments of boredom or accelerate when we are engaged in enjoyable activities. This psychological aspect of time perception has intrigued psychologists and neuroscientists for decades.
Theories like the “proportional theory” suggest that our sense of time is tied to the number of memorable events that occur during a given period. As a result, a year in childhood, with numerous novel experiences, appears to last longer than a year in adulthood, which often becomes routine.
Time in Physics
In the realm of physics, our understanding of time took a monumental leap with Albert Einstein’s theory of relativity. His theories, special and general relativity, challenged conventional notions of space and time. Special relativity introduced the concept that time is relative and can dilate or contract depending on an observer’s motion. General relativity expanded this idea by linking gravity to the curvature of spacetime, demonstrating that massive objects, such as planets, influence the flow of time around them.

The Arrow of Time
The “arrow of time” is a philosophical and scientific concept that reflects the apparent irreversibility of time’s flow. We experience time as moving forward, from past to present to future. However, certain physical processes, such as the behavior of subatomic particles, appear to be time-symmetric, leading to a paradox known as the “arrow of time” problem.
This paradox raises intriguing questions about the fundamental nature of time and the possible existence of parallel universes where time might flow in different directions. Some theories, like the “block universe” model, propose that the past, present, and future all coexist simultaneously.
